Verse (16:112), Word 3 - Quranic Grammar

__

The third word of verse (16:112) is an indefinite masculine noun and is in the accusative case (منصوب). The noun's triliteral root is mīm thā lām (م ث ل).

Chapter (16) sūrat l-naḥl (The Bees)


(16:112:3)
mathalan
a similitude
N – accusative masculine indefinite noun اسم منصوب

Verse (16:112)

The analysis above refers to the 112th verse of chapter 16 (sūrat l-naḥl):

Sahih International: And Allah presents an example: a city which was safe and secure, its provision coming to it in abundance from every location, but it denied the favors of Allah. So Allah made it taste the envelopment of hunger and fear for what they had been doing.
